About 1700 York Associates

1700 York Associates is a well-regarded and reliable corporate owner. Across their buildings, tenants rate them 4.6/5 across 1 review, with 100% recommending their buildings and 100% approving of them as an owner or associate. Their portfolio records 1 eviction, 6 open violations, and 0 litigation cases. Data last updated September 12, 2026. 1700 York Associates is a corporate owner associated with 1 building and 162 units across Yorkville in Manhattan. The portfolio is concentrated in Yorkville in Manhattan. The building was built in 1951 and consists of primarily mid-rise structures. All of the associated buildings have rent-stabilized apartments. Former tenant·Over 3 years ago

Safe, clean, and quiet

Pros

If your parents are worried about safety, this building will put them at ease. The area is super quiet and well lit. You have a 24/7 doorman and maintenance crew. They were all super nice and great at keeping track of packages for every tenant. The building is very clean. I saw no pests the entire year of my lease. My roommate saw one house centipede. The building also has an elevator and laundry room. We didn't have any maintenance issues. Phoning management can be a hassle. Email worked better for us, so response time was maybe a day. The C-town grocery store was relatively affordable. Check out Heavenly Market and Pho Shop if you're in the area. If friends with cars are driving into Manhattan to visit you, free parking is available nearby. It's definitely less stressful parking here compared to other areas of Manhattan. I don't regret living here. I think it was a good transition apartment from suburbs to city.

Cons

The area has restaurants and bars but caters more to an older crowd. I preferred going to Midtown for food and entertainment. The commute can feel long. The Q and 6 train are far. Walking over takes 15 min (long by NYC standards). There's a bus if you're feeling lazy. My neighbors were quiet, and we didn't interact much. My downstairs neighbor did complain about us making chair scraping sounds to the doorman or management. Doorman let us know. We were more mindful about it. Doorman told us they didn't hear any more noise. No drama. We were in the wrong, but it did stick with me for being a little petty. Oh and since the staff is pretty large (5+ people), tipping during Xmas gets expensive. Decision to move was based on price (UES can be super pricey) and wanting to live closer to work in a busier area.

Advice to the owners

Keep the staff members you have cause they're awesome. My upgrade wish would be ceilings lights.

Open violations

From past 10 years · Updated 5 days ago

Average violations per unit for this owner or associate is better than the city average.

Owner average0.03Violations per unit
NYC average0.81Violations per unit
1Class C
Immediately hazardous

Rodents, pest, mold, inadequate heat or hot water, defective building parts

3Class B
Hazardous

Smoke detector issues, inadequate lighting, no lighting for stairways

2Class A
Non-hazardous

No peephole on a door, no street number on the building, unlawful keeping of animals

0Class I
Missing info

Missing or non-compliant with administrative information orders or filings
